Players navigate dynamically changing levels across five worlds, customizing ships and upgrades to face relentless enemies and epic evolving bosses. With multiple difficulty settings and varied game modes, it offers high challenge and replayability.

The game features over 45 challenging levels, puzzles, boss fights, and a quirky original soundtrack. With compelling visuals, players must balance movement and combat while avoiding traps and enjoying charming 3D environments.

The game speeds up every 15 seconds, challenging your reaction speed and perception. With electronic music beats to guide you and competitive leaderboards to climb, see how far you can go in this ultimate test of reflexes.
